i have a question:

Is it possible to mod some files, so that i can fire the cannons in the 1st person view as in the 3rd person without aiming ?
 
As of right now, as far as I understand, in Build 13 that's the default way of firing. To fire manually in 1st person view press "V".

If you don't want to use automatic aiming don't use it. It's very simple.

Some people want to be able to fire the same way in first person as in third, so I added that ability. Now you don't have to go to third person view every time you want to fire your cannons.

We can't eliminate manual aiming, because sometimes you have to fire at something that isn't considered a target by the game (neutral ship, for example) or to aim higher to hit sails.

Part of the reason I added automatic aiming for first person was so that I could use a voice command program to give all commands in first person by speaking them into a microphone, never having to touch the keyboard.

I use automatic aiming all the time. I hardly ever do manual aiming myself. You can set everything back to normal by setting AUTO_AIMED_FIRE to 0 in BuildSettings.h. Then set controls back to default and press to reinitialize. After that, everything works exactly how it always worked again. <img src="style_emoticons/<#EMO_DIR#>/yes.gif" style="vertical-align:middle" emoid=":yes" border="0" alt="yes.gif" />

I've done a little work on that one too. After watching my character with accuracy 6 missing wildly enough times I put in an additional calculation to use a normalized random number as well as the original calculation. You'll still get wild misses once in a while, but sometimes the aiming will be somewhat more accurate, with more shots hitting toward the center of your aim than way off to one side.

I also added a slight increase to the minimum radius the game uses to calculate the hit point so that at accuracy 10 you won't be putting your entire broadside into a one foot circle on the enemy ship. <img src="style_emoticons/<#EMO_DIR#>/smile.gif" style="vertical-align:middle" emoid=":)" border="0" alt="smile.gif" />

I've tested these in a lot of sea battles, both myself against an enemy ship and watching fleet actions between two opposing forces, and it's looking pretty good.

You'll still need to do manual aiming if you want to target the enemy ship's sails with roundshot. And of course you can fire manually on every shot if you prefer.
